It’s a project I’ve built over years and it’s life changingly good and gets better as home assistant, esphome, wled, and LLMs improve. I spend little time futzing with it as it all generally works, but obviously some minor expertise is required to make your own esp32 projects which are mostly just wiring off the shelf wroom d1 mini boards to a project board on the uart/gpio, whatever on something else. My minisplits, jucuzzi, garage door, blinds, etc all have active esphome projects, and provisioning is simple for a technical person. Home assistant is really simple too, and if you know jinja templating, you can make masterpieces.
No one has boiled it down to a shrink wrap product and that is sad for the mass. But for someone with moderate technical skills you can achieve anything your creativity and bravery will afford, and with AI coding assistants it’s gotten even easier. I had to replace most the switches with zwave switches, and build a bunch of boards and attach them to control ports built into devices I own like the minisplits, hottub, etc. But these are all not hard things to do - they’re just more laborious and tedious one time activities, and once you’ve set it up home assistant and esphome are pretty good about not breaking you in the future.
My washing machine also has home assistant integrations, etc, and I am careful to only buy things that do. And most things do one way or another.

I do think that Matter is designed with a commercial, cloud-based fabric in mind. Normal people don't want to have even a smart home router, let alone run a local fabric.
> Normal people don't want to have even a smart home router, let alone run a local fabric.
That’s fair, I guess, but _something_ has to coordinate things. I’m not aware of how Samsung, Google and others do it as I’m only familiar with Home Assistant and HomeKit, but the main difference between those 2 is that with Home Assistant that _something_ is whatever runs HA (I have it on a VM, but a lot of people run it on SBCs or one of the official appliances), and the Apple ecosystem relies on other devices people bought in are likely to already own (iPads, Apple TVs, HomePods, …).
In either case, the controller device is there and requires no Internet access to operate. Possibly during commissioning of a new device - I haven’t checked - but that’s it.
You don't need any coordination for basic scenarios like a wireless switch in a room controls the lights in that room.
Depending on whether the underlying protocol allows forwarding and can establish the minimum spanning tree, you might need a repeater if you want all-on/all-off kind of functionality in a large home.
The coordinator, which in Matter is a thread border router, translates between the Thread and WiFi networks, which is what allows app or cloud based control, including "automations" like reactions and schedules.
You generally don't need a Thread Border Router to combine one manufacturer's products together, e.g. Phillips Hue, but it will use Bluetooth instead of Thread/ZigBee.
